Student difficulties with representations of quantum operators corresponding to observables

arXiv:1701.01411 · doi:10.1119/perc.2016.pr.049

Abstract

Dirac notation is used commonly in quantum mechanics. However, many upper-level undergraduate and graduate students in physics have difficulties with representations of quantum operators corresponding to observables especially when using Dirac notation. To investigate these difficulties, we administered free-response and multiple-choice questions and conducted individual interviews with students in advanced quantum mechanics courses. We discuss the analysis of data on the common difficulties found.
